导读:MongoDB是一种非关系型数据库,它可以帮助开发人员存储、索引和检索大量数据 。本文将讨论MongoDB是否会发生死锁 。
1. 什么是死锁?
死锁是指多个程序或进程之间相互等待彼此持有的资源,从而导致系统无法继续执行的状态 。
【mongodb过时了吗 mongodb 会死锁吗】2. MongoDB会发生死锁吗?
MongoDB不会发生死锁 。MongoDB使用了一种叫做“乐观锁”的技术来避免死锁 。它的原理是,在更新数据之前 , 先检查是否有其他事务正在修改该数据,如果有 , 则放弃更新,直到其他事务完成更新 。
3. MongoDB的其他安全措施
MongoDB还采用了其他安全措施,例如提供授权访问,使用SSL/TLS加密,防止数据泄露和篡改,以及使用复制集和分片来保护数据 。
总结:MongoDB不会发生死锁,因为它使用了乐观锁技术来避免死锁 。此外,MongoDB还采用了其他安全措施来保护数据安全 。
- mongodb 更新子文档 mongodb数据文件无法新建
- 客户端无法连接到异速联服务器 客户端无法连接mongodb
- mongodb大公司案例 MongoDB公司怎么样
- mongodb查看数据库大小 查看mongodb集群容量
- 无法启动mongodb 1053 安装mongodb显示没有启动权
- mongodb用来存储什么 mongodb适合存储对象吗
- mysql下到了c盘 mysql怎么不存到c盘
- mongodb数据丢失原因 为什么mongodb数据库一直在加载中
- mongodb查询字符串字段包含 mongodb查询字段不为空
- 联合索引怎么创建 联合索引mongodb
